What to Consider When Choosing a Sofa
Choosing the ideal sofa involves a number of factors to consider:
- Size: Measure your space to figure out how big or small your sofa should be.
- Design: Identify the design that fits your design-- contemporary, traditional, or eclectic.
- Material: Opt for a fabric that lines up with your way of life-- long lasting choices for households or luxurious materials for a refined touch.
- Comfort: Prioritize great assistance, specifically if you intend on costs long hours on your sofa.
- Spending plan: Set a rate variety; quality sofas can be discovered at numerous cost points.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Your Sofa Questions Answered
1. What size sofa should I choose for my living-room?
The perfect size depends on your space's dimensions and just how much space you wish to designate for walking and other furniture. It's practical to measure your room and picture the sofa in the space before buying.
2. How do I preserve my sofa?
Maintenance differs by product. Routine vacuuming is necessary for material sofas, while leather sofas can be wiped down with a wet cloth. Constantly describe the manufacturer's care guidelines for specific cleansing guidelines.
3. Can I customize my sofa?
Lots of brands, like Joybird and West Elm, use personalization options relating to material, color, and shape. This enables you to tailor the sofa to match your style and space.
4. Are there any environment-friendly sofa choices?
Yes, numerous brands focus on sustainability, providing sofas made from recycled materials or sustainably sourced wood. Brand names like Joybird and West Elm often include environment-friendly collections.
5. How much should I invest in a sofa?
Sofa costs can vary from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Consider your spending plan, the frequency of use, and how long you plan to keep it. Buying a higher-quality sofa frequently pays off in convenience and sturdiness.
